Microsoft Signs 7 Million Ton Carbon Removal Agreement
Microsoft signed a long-term agreement to receive nature-based carbon removal from its afforestation, reforestation and revegetation (ARR) project in the southern U.S., including Arkansas, Texas, and Louisiana.

IKEA Increases RE Use, Lowers Emissions
Retailer IKEA announced that its use of renewable energy in IKEA retail and other operations grew to 71% in FY24 from 67% in FY23, with its share of renewable electricity increasing from 77% to 81%.

J.B. Hunt Deploys Solar at Headquarters
J.B. Hunt Transport Services Inc., a supply chain solutions provider, announced the launch of its solar facility in Gentry, Arkansas that will generate enough electricity to offset up to 80% of the power used by its three main corporate campus buildings in Lowell.

Rio Tinto Partners to Accelerate Carbon Capture Tech
Rio Tinto, a metals and mining company, entered into a partnership to identify and evaluate available carbon capture technologies for future implementation in the aluminum electrolysis process.
